I ain't sure...Vilali makes a great posterboy and probably would be a popular leader, but the politics of this situation are somewhat more complex than you'll generally see reported. Ukraine is caught between two major economic interests and only time will tell which is best for the Ukrainian people. Currently Ukraine is a major trading partner with Russia (although the weaker partner) - a trading alignment with the EU could relegate them to the status of Greece or Spain - basically a supplier of raw materials and a market for European goods with very little economic influence of their own. As I understand it, the major reason for the current dispute in Ukraine is that the trading agreement with Europe would come at the cost of the beneficial agreements already in place with Russia (cos Russia can't risk being flooded with untaxed EU manufactured goods) - this is genuinely a major risk for the country as Ukraine is massively dependent on Russian petrochemicals and energy supplies. However the Ukrainian market - even more so if the Russian market can be penetrated simultaneously - would be a huge prize for the struggling economies of the EU - Hence the strong support (and possible bankrolling) for the pro-EU demonstators from the EU and in the Western media.
